  • Publication number: 20090117315
    Abstract: An object is to improve the durability of a mold and reduce the cost of the mold. A disc-molding mold includes a first mold; and a second mold disposed in opposition to the first mold such that the second mold can advance and retreat. One of the first and second molds includes a base material having a roughened surface, and a coating layer formed on the surface of the base material through coating treatment. A stamper attachment surface is defined on a surface of the coating layer. Since a coating layer is formed on the roughened surface of the base material through coating treatment, the area of contact between the base material and the coating layer can be increased. Therefore, the adhesion force between the base material and the coating layer increases, so that the coating layer becomes unlikely to peel off, whereby the durability of the mold can be improved, and the cost of the mold can be reduced.
